Double insulation is a design concept used in electric
power tools which eliminates the need for the three wire
grounded power cord and grounded power supply system. It
is a recognized and approved system by Underwriter’s
Laboratories, CSA and Federal OSHA authorities.
Servicing of a tool with double insulation
requires care and knowledge of the
system and should be performed only by a qualified service
technician.
WHEN SERVICING, USE ONLY
IDENTICAL REPLACEMENT PARTS.
POLARIZED PLUGS. To reduce the risk
of electrical shock, your tool is equipped
with a polarized plug (one blade is wider than the other), this
plug will fit in a polarized outlet only one way. If the plug does
not fit fully in the outlet, reverse the plug. If it still does not fit,
contact a qualified electrician to install the proper outlet. To
reduce the risk of electrical shock, do not change the plug in
any way.

Replace damaged cords immediately.
Use of damaged cords can shock, burn or
electrocute.
If an extension cord is necessary, a cord
with adequate size conductors should be
used to prevent excessive voltage drop, loss of power or
overheating. The table shows the correct size to use,
depending on cord length and nameplate amperage rating of
tool. If in doubt, use the next heavier gauge. Always use U.L.
and CSA listed extension cords.
